Read moreShaftesbury PLC - London-based real estate investment trust - At March 31, says indicative external valuation of its wholly-owned properties was GBP3.36 billion. This represents a 8.3% increase against its valuation of GBP3.01 billion at September 30. On a like-for-like basis this represents an increase of 7.5%. Company explains increase was driven by like-for-like estimated rental value growth of 6.4% over the six months to March 31. This, it continues, reflects sustained occupier demand and low levels of vacancy. Trading returning towards pre-pandemic levels, it adds.
